Frequent Reasons and Ways to Prevent of Clogged Sewers
Blocked pipes are often the result of a buildup of substances that should not be thrown away through your drainage system. Typical offenders are hair, soap scum, food particles, grease, and other items. Strands of hair, especially in restroom basins and bathtubs, can create knotted clumps that catch additional debris. In the kitchen, putting oils and oils down the drain adds significantly to the accumulation of grease, which hardens and creates blockages over time. Understanding these causes is the initial step in preventing clogs.

To prevent these common issues, consider implementing a number of key practices. In restrooms, employing drain strainers can effectively collect hair and stop it from entering the drain. Regular maintenance of your sink and bathtub drains is essential to remove soapy residue and buildup. In addition, inform all members of the household on proper disposal methods to minimize the likelihood of clogging.

In business settings, prevention strategies are just as important. Regular maintenance checks should be performed to spot potential problems before they worsen. Commercial establishments should set up grease traps, especially in food service environments, to prevent fats from entering the sewer system. Regularly scheduled cleaning and expert assessments can help keep drains clear and functioning smoothly, ensuring a safe and efficient environment for all.

DIY Methods for Unclogging Drains
One effective DIY technique for unclogging drains includes using a combination of baking soda and vinegar. Start by pouring 1/2 cup of baking soda down the drain, followed by 1/2 cup of vinegar. Let it to fizz and sit for about half an hour, then rinse it with hot water. This natural solution can help remove minor clogs caused by grease, hair, and soap residue without harming your pipes.

Another useful technique is using a plunger, especially for kitchen sinks and toilets. Ensure you use a proper cup plunger for sinks and a flange plunger for toilets. To use it, cover the drain completely with the plunger and push down firmly before pulling up quickly. Do this multiple times to create suction that can free the clog. If done correctly, this method can provide quick relief to your blocked drains without the need for harsh chemicals.

If you're facing a particularly stubborn clog, a drain snake can be an invaluable tool. A drain snake, or auger, is designed to reach deep into the pipes to break up or remove blockages. Insert the snake into the drain and turn the handle clockwise until you feel resistance. This is likely the clog; continue rotating to break it apart or pull it out. After you feel the blockage has been cleared, flush the drain with hot water to remove any remaining debris.

When the time to Call a qualified Professional Plumber

There are several circumstances when it is crucial to seek the help of a certified plumbing specialist. If you discover that your efforts at clearing the clog are unsuccessful and the problem continues, it's a clear sign that the blockage may be deeper in the plumbing system or more intricate than expected. Additionally, if you notice indications of backflow in several sink outlets, this could indicate a more significant issue, such as a blockage in the main sewer pipeline, which demands prompt care.

Another reason to call a qualified occurs when you notice any suspected issues to your pipes, such as water leaks or fractures, while trying to clear the clog. Overlooking these problems can lead to costly fixes down the road and create an unhealthy living environment due to water damage or mold. A certified plumber possesses the expertise to analyze the condition accurately and recommend the best steps.

Lastly, if you experience repeated clogs despite adhering to preventive measures, it may indicate an issue beneath the surface problem that needs professional diagnosis. Regular check-ups and inspection by a plumber can help detect issues like tree root intrusion or pipe deterioration, ensuring your plumbing stays functional and operational. Getting expert assistance in these situations can reduce your resources, labor, and money in the long run.
